Jury Orders Abbott to Pay $70M in Preterm Infant Formula Trial

Share!

Insurance Journal - Apr 13, 2026

A jury in Chicago said Abbott Laboratories must pay $70 million in damages to a group of families that had accused the company of failing to warn that its formula for premature infants can cause a potentially deadly bowel disease, …...
